Output 595d6d698ea155b66ad16ca5d0de11eb0b2741156ca4a9eb3b724c69c7b1106e:1

value
7908332
script pubkey
OP_0 OP_PUSHBYTES_32 b39a73f6b9690e041a3eb5bd581b151aac233bd70acff66a698ed61f05d23093
address
bc1qkwd88a4edy8qgx37kk74sxc4r2kzxw7hpt8lv6nf3mtp7pwjxzfs7waydn
transaction
595d6d698ea155b66ad16ca5d0de11eb0b2741156ca4a9eb3b724c69c7b1106e
confirmations
488
spent
true